How you will make a difference: 

This position has primary responsibility for administrative support of TEAMMATES services. This position performs a wide variety of clerical and administrative tasks including typing, preparing reports, entering data, maintaining files, assisting with TM Supervisors and Coordinators intake process, receiving visitors, and processing confidential information. Additionally, the position will assist with billing audits, chart reviews, tracking reports and forms, creating reports, and general QA tasks assigned. Office Assistants may assist with audits conducted at any center under the facilitation of the Administrative Services Director, the QA Manager, the TEAMMATES Clinical Data Assistant, or the Medical Records Coordinator. 

 

Division/Program Overview:  

  • Community-Based and Family Centered programs. 

  • TEAMMATES offers Wraparound, Intensive Field Capable Clinical Services (IFCCS) and IFCCS Outreach Triage Team and Child Outreach Triage Team services that cover a full range of treatment and support. 

  • 24 hours of referral receipt, and services are delivered countywide by the same team 

  • 24-hour Crisis Intervention 

  • SED Children and Adolescent driven program.  

  • Client and Family driven program with mutually agreed by service provider and family.  

  • Contract with DMH and Child Protected Services and Probation.
